Why Everson Siding Wears Out Faster Than the Brochure Says
Everson sits inland from the water compared to Blaine proper, but it's still squarely inside the same Whatcom County weather system — moist Salish Sea air, long wet stretches from fall through spring, and short, cool summers that never fully dry out a north-facing wall. That combination is hard on siding in three specific ways: salt-laden air corrodes fasteners and finishes over time, driving rain gets pushed sideways into laps and seams during winter storms, and a long moss season keeps shaded siding damp for weeks at a stretch. None of that is dramatic on its own. It's cumulative. A siding system that's rated for a dry climate, or installed with shortcuts that work fine in Arizona, starts showing problems here in years, not decades.
We bring this up first because it changes what "siding replacement" should actually mean for a home in this area. It's not just swapping old material for new material in the same color. It's an opportunity to fix whatever let moisture and rot get a foothold in the first place, and to put up a system that's actually built for this climate instead of one that's merely available at the lumber yard.

Signs an Everson Home Needs Siding Replaced, Not Patched
Homeowners often call us wanting a repair, and sometimes a repair is genuinely the right answer. But there's a point where patching individual boards stops making sense and full replacement becomes the more honest recommendation. Here's what we look for during a walk-around:
- Soft or spongy spots when you press on the siding, especially near the bottom courses and around window trim
- Paint that won't hold anymore — recurring peeling or bubbling within a year or two of repainting
- Persistent moss or black-green staining on north- and west-facing walls that comes back within a season of cleaning
- Visible warping, cupping, or gaps opening up between boards
- Siding that was installed directly over old material without a proper water-resistive barrier
- Consistently musty smell or damp drywall on interior walls that back up to exterior siding
Any one of these can sometimes be addressed locally. Several of them together, especially on a home more than 20-25 years old, usually mean the underlying weather barrier has failed and the siding itself has absorbed more moisture than it can shed. At that point, patching just buys a little time before the same failure shows up somewhere else on the wall.
What a Correct Siding Replacement Actually Involves
Full Tear-Off, Not Overlay
We remove the old siding down to the sheathing rather than installing new material over top of it. Siding-over-siding traps whatever moisture damage already exists behind a fresh face, which just delays the problem and makes it worse when it eventually resurfaces. Tear-off also lets us actually inspect the sheathing and framing underneath instead of guessing.
Inspect and Repair What's Behind the Wall
Once the old siding is off, we check the sheathing for soft spots, rot, or water staining, and we check the framing at window and door openings, since that's where leaks concentrate. Any compromised sheathing gets replaced before anything new goes up — installing new siding over rotten sheathing just wastes the new siding.
Water-Resistive Barrier and Flashing
A new weather-resistive barrier goes on correctly lapped, shingle-style, so water sheds downward and outward rather than working its way behind seams. Flashing at windows, doors, and any wall penetrations gets installed to direct water out and away from the sheathing, not just tucked in as an afterthought. Given how much driving rain this area sees off the Strait, this step matters more here than it does in drier climates — it's the difference between siding that's cosmetic and siding that's actually doing its job as a water management system.
Correct Fastening and Clearances
Fiber cement siding has manufacturer-specified fastener types, spacing, and clearances from grade, decks, and roof lines, and those specs exist for a reason — get them wrong and you create entry points for moisture no matter how good the material is. We hold to those specs rather than treating them as optional.
Material Comparison for This Climate
We only install James Hardie fiber cement siding, and we're upfront about why. Here's how the common options actually compare for a home dealing with salt air, sideways rain, and long damp stretches:
| Material | How it handles moisture here | Long-term maintenance | Fire performance |
|---|---|---|---|
| James Hardie fiber cement | Dimensionally stable, doesn't swell or rot when wet, ColorPlus finish resists fading and peeling | Low — occasional wash, repaint not required for years | Non-combustible |
| Vinyl siding | Sheds water on the face but seams and J-channels can trap moisture; warps and becomes brittle in temperature swings | Low labor but limited repair options if cracked or faded | Melts/deforms under heat |
| LP SmartSide (engineered wood) | Treated to resist moisture but still wood-based; edge and cut-end sealing is critical and easy to get wrong | Moderate — repainting on a cycle, careful caulk maintenance | Combustible |
| Cedar / primed spruce | Natural material, absorbs and releases moisture constantly, prone to cupping and checking in wet climates | High — regular refinishing, more vulnerable to moss and rot | Combustible |
Every one of those products has legitimate use cases somewhere. In a climate with this much sustained moisture exposure, though, fiber cement's dimensional stability and non-combustible composition are why we standardized on it rather than offering a menu of options we'd have to caveat differently for every job.
Cost Factors for an Everson Siding Replacement
We don't quote firm numbers without seeing the home, but the main variables that move the price on a project like this are consistent from job to job:
| Factor | Why it matters |
|---|---|
| Home size and wall complexity | More corners, gables, and dormers mean more cutting, flashing, and labor time |
| Condition of the sheathing underneath | Hidden rot found during tear-off adds repair scope that can't be priced sight-unseen |
| Siding profile chosen | Lap siding, panel systems, and shingle-style Hardie products differ in material and install time |
| Trim and accessory work | Window trim, corner boards, and soffit/fascia work are often bundled with a re-side for a clean finished look |
| Access and site conditions | Landscaping, fencing, decks, or tight lot lines can add setup and staging time |

Why It Matters to Hire a Crew That Already Works This Area
Siding installation isn't uniform across climates, and a crew that mostly works drier inland regions will make different — sometimes wrong — default decisions than one that installs against Whatcom County weather every season. Flashing details that are "good enough" in a dry climate aren't good enough here. Fastener spacing that looks fine on paper can fail faster once salt air and repeated wet-dry cycling get involved. A crew with local experience already knows which details actually matter for homes exposed to this specific combination of rain, humidity, and moss, and doesn't need to relearn that on your house.
There's also a practical scheduling reality: this region has a real wet season, and siding work has weather windows. A local crew plans installs around that instead of treating every week as equally workable.
Life After Replacement: What Ongoing Care Looks Like
Correctly installed Hardie siding is genuinely low-maintenance, but "low-maintenance" isn't "no-maintenance." A yearly rinse-down to knock back moss and pollen buildup, especially on shaded north-facing walls, keeps the ColorPlus finish looking like it should. Keep an eye on caulking at trim joints and touch it up if it starts to crack or pull away — caulk is a maintenance item on any siding system, Hardie included. Keep gutters clear and downspouts directed away from the foundation, since a lot of siding failures actually start as grading or drainage problems, not siding problems. None of this is heavy work, but skipping it entirely shortens the life of even the best material.
